What Is Homeowners Insurance and Why Do You Need It?
Homeowners insurance protects you financially when your home or belongings are damaged or stolen. It also provides coverage if youโre liable for injuries or property damage. While not legally required, most mortgage lenders insist on it, making it an essential part of homeownership.
Imagine this: A fire damages your kitchen, or a storm blows shingles off your roof. Without homeowners insurance, youโd be stuck paying for these repairs out of pocket. With the right policy, you can focus on getting your life back to normal instead of worrying about bills.
What Does Homeowners Insurance Cover?
Your policy can include several types of coverage to safeguard your home, belongings, and finances. Hereโs a breakdown:
1. Dwelling Coverage
Dwelling coverage protects your homeโs structure, including walls, roof, and attached structures, against perils like fire, windstorms, and hail.
- Example: A lightning strike damages your roof. This coverage helps you pay for repairs or replacement.
2. Personal Property Coverage
This helps replace your belongings if theyโre stolen or damaged in a covered event.
- Example: If a thief steals your electronics or jewelry, personal property coverage can cover the cost of replacing them.
3. Liability Coverage
Liability insurance covers costs if youโre responsible for injuries or property damage to others.
- Example: If your dog bites a visitor or a tree in your yard damages a neighborโs car, this coverage can help pay medical or repair bills.
4. Loss of Use Coverage
If your home is uninhabitable due to covered damage, this pays for temporary living expenses like rent or hotel stays.
- Example: After a house fire, you need to rent an apartment while repairs are underway. Loss of use coverage helps cover these costs.
5. Medical Payments to Others
This provides limited coverage for medical expenses if someone is injured on your property, regardless of whoโs at fault.
- Example: A neighborโs child trips on your patio steps and needs stitches. Medical payments coverage can help pay for the ER visit.
Additional Coverage Options
Many insurers offer optional coverage to enhance your policy. Here are some popular add-ons:
Water Damage Coverage
Covers sudden leaks from appliances or plumbing but not flooding.
- Example: Your washing machine malfunctions and floods the laundry room. This coverage can pay for repairs.
Guaranteed Replacement Cost
Pays for the full cost of rebuilding your home, even if it exceeds policy limits due to rising construction costs.
- Example: A tornado levels your house. Rebuilding costs exceed your dwelling limit, but this coverage pays the extra amount.
Umbrella Insurance
Provides extra liability protection beyond your policy limits, ideal for safeguarding high-value assets.
- Example: A guest sues you for injuries sustained on your property, and their medical bills exceed your liability limit. Umbrella insurance steps in to cover the difference.
How to Choose the Right Homeowners Insurance
Selecting the right policy can feel overwhelming, but following these steps can make it easier:
1. Assess Your Coverage Needs
Consider factors like:
- The cost to rebuild your home (not its market value).
- The value of your belongings.
- Your total financial assets to determine liability limits.
2. Get an Accurate Quote
Provide detailed information about your home, including:
- Address and year built.
- Square footage and materials.
- Safety features like smoke detectors or alarm systems.
3. Consider Your Budget
Decide on deductibles and limits that balance affordability with adequate protection. Remember, higher deductibles often mean lower premiums.
4. Compare Policies
Different insurers offer varying rates and coverage options. Shop around to find the best fit for your needs and budget.
How Much Does Homeowners Insurance Cost?
The average annual premium for a standard HO-3 policy is about $1,200, but costs vary depending on:
- Location: Homes in areas prone to natural disasters typically cost more to insure.
- Home Details: Age, size, materials, and safety features influence your rate.
- Coverage Levels: Higher limits and additional options increase premiums.
Tips to Lower Your Homeowners Insurance Costs
Want to save money on your policy? Try these strategies:
- Bundle Policies: Combine home and auto insurance with the same company for discounts.
- Increase Deductibles: Opt for a higher deductible to lower your premium.
- Improve Home Security: Install alarms, deadbolts, and smoke detectors for potential savings.
- Maintain a Claims-Free History: Avoid filing small claims to keep rates low.
- Ask About Discounts: Many insurers offer discounts for new homeowners, seniors, or safety upgrades.
Frequently Asked Questions About Homeowners Insurance
1. Is Homeowners Insurance Required?
Legally, no. However, mortgage lenders typically require it, and itโs wise to protect your investment.
2. Does Homeowners Insurance Cover Flooding?
Standard policies donโt cover flooding. Youโll need a separate flood insurance policy if you live in a flood-prone area.
3. How Do I Estimate Rebuilding Costs?
Multiply your homeโs square footage by local per-square-foot building costs. A local contractor can provide an accurate estimate.
4. Can I Customize My Policy?
Absolutely! Many insurers offer flexible options to tailor coverage to your specific needs.
